Abstract

Robust ecological assessments are fundamental for effective wildlife conservation. Owing to the high legal protection of bats, surveys are frequently required as part of ecological assessments. Yet there is uncertainty about the amount of survey effort that should be deployed to facilitate bat protection. Bat activity can be extremely variable, and capturing periods of high activity can be as important as estimating parameters such as the median activity level. However the frequency and intensity of surveys required to capture the required information is unknown. Here we assessed the probability that acoustic surveys of differing durations would detect periods of high activity within a focal site and the importance of a site relative to others in a regional or national context. We randomly subsampled from 660 nights of activity data collected from 33 wind farm sites across Britain. The minimum surveying effort required to classify bat activity accurately varied between species and was dependent on weather conditions. We found that the survey periods required to give reasonable cer tainty in assessing risk exceeded those currently recommended in Europe. The approach of using bat activity accumulation curves, as described here, is transferrable to other situations where determining surveying effort and risk is necessary to ensure that ecological assessments provide a robust evidence base, whilst minimising the time and expense of surveys.

 

摘要:

稳健的生态评估是有效保护野生动物的基础。由于蝙蝠受到高度的法律保护,经常需要进行调查作为生态评估的一部分。然而,为促进蝙蝠保护而应投入的调查工作量尚不确定。蝙蝠活动可能变化极大,捕捉高活动期可能与估计活动水平中位数等参数同样重要。然而,获取所需信息所需的调查频率和强度尚不清楚。在这里,我们评估了不同持续时间的声学调查在焦点地点内检测到高活动期的概率,以及在区域或国家背景下,一个地点相对于其他地点的重要性。我们从英国33个风电场收集的660个晚上的活动数据中随机抽样。准确分类蝙蝠活动所需的最小调查工作量因物种而异,并取决于天气条件。我们发现,在评估风险时给予合理确定性所需的调查期超过了欧洲目前建议的调查期。如本文所述,使用蝙蝠活动累积曲线的方法可以转移到其他情况,在这些情况下,有必要确定调查工作和风险,以确保生态评估提供强有力的证据基础,同时最大限度地减少调查的时间和费用。
